Output 8dc93d3ffc83b1af57d9d782018243759f7b61dcbd795242cb6151c079a61071:1

value
7570393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cc9cbe52141bd1ea84a40ec893227fad7216a14 OP_EQUALVERIFY OP_CHECKSIG
address
1M8RQGUoedbgi9CiSRoX2RkTu9A4nxhF1a
transaction
8dc93d3ffc83b1af57d9d782018243759f7b61dcbd795242cb6151c079a61071
confirmations
432866
spent
true